SCUBAPRO Sport Mesh 'N Roll 100 Wheeled Dive Bag
Pros:
- Durable Design: The SCUBAPRO Sport Mesh 'N Roll 100 is crafted from heavy-duty coated mesh material, making it strong enough to withstand the rigors of travel and frequent use. Whether you're hauling it across rugged terrain or loading it into a dive boat, this bag holds up well to tough conditions.
- Lightweight & Breathable: The mesh sides are a real standout, significantly cutting down on the overall weight of the bag while also allowing wet gear to drain efficiently after your dive. This is especially important for those who want to avoid the musty, mildew smell that can come from trapped moisture.
- Versatile Carrying Options: Featuring double duffel straps with a padded handle, this bag offers both a comfortable carry by hand or the option to wear it as a backpack. This versatility comes in handy when you're navigating crowded airports or hopping from one dive spot to the next.
- Convenient Storage Pockets: The internal top and side external zippered pockets offer quick access to smaller items like keys, masks, or dive accessories. The ability to store your personal items separately from your gear helps keep things organized and easy to find.
- Adjustable Rolling Handle: The adjustable top carry handle makes it easy to roll the bag with minimal effort, which is perfect when you’re loaded down with heavy dive equipment. The smooth rolling wheels take much of the strain off your back, making travel to the dive site a breeze.
- Saltwater-Resistant Wheels: Designed with saltwater-resistant wheels treated to withstand corrosion, this bag is built for divers who frequent ocean-side locations. The durability of the wheels makes it easy to roll the bag even on sandy or wet surfaces.
- Foldable for Easy Storage: After the dive, this bag can be folded down to save space in your storage area, making it ideal for people with limited storage space between trips. The foldability doesn’t compromise on its size or functionality during use.
Cons:
- Bulkier than Standard Duffels: While the SCUBAPRO Sport Mesh 'N Roll 100 is designed for scuba gear, its size may be considered bulky for those who prefer a more compact, everyday duffel bag for light trips. It takes up significant space when not in use.
- Weight: At 5.5 pounds (2.514 kg), this bag is a bit heavier than some non-wheeled alternatives, which may be a downside for divers looking for an ultra-lightweight solution. However, the added weight is largely due to the reinforced materials and extra durability, making it a trade-off for sturdier construction.
- No Additional Internal Compartments: While the zippered pockets provide some organization, the lack of internal compartments within the main section might make it a bit difficult to keep larger gear items neatly arranged. Larger dive accessories could shift around during transport if not packed properly.
- Not Ideal for Short-Term, Quick Trips: The SCUBAPRO Sport Mesh 'N Roll 100 is built for large-scale gear transport, making it less suitable for short, quick diving trips where minimal gear is required. For divers who need to pack light, this bag might be more than what’s necessary.
- Price Point: The price of this bag can be on the higher end compared to some other options available. While the quality justifies the price, it may not be the best fit for those looking for a more budget-friendly option for casual diving or occasional trips.
Fitdom 90L Large Mesh Duffle Bag for Scuba Dive or Snorkel Equipment
Pros:
- Water-Resistant Mesh: The Fitdom 90L Large Mesh Duffle Bag stands out with its water-resistant mesh construction. This feature ensures that your diving or snorkeling gear dries off quickly after use, preventing any lingering moisture or mildew. If you’ve ever been frustrated with wet gear in your bag, this solves the problem effortlessly by allowing the gear to air out while keeping everything protected.
- Durable and Sturdy Construction: Unlike other mesh bags that may bend or stretch with heavy gear, this bag is made with high-quality UV-resistant mesh and reinforced by four strong panels. This ensures the bag holds up under pressure, capable of handling up to 30 lbs of gear. It's perfect for those who need a bag that can withstand rugged use without losing its shape or durability.
- Multiple Organized Compartments: This bag is designed with efficiency in mind, featuring a total of six compartments. The spacious main pocket accommodates large gear like wetsuits and fins, while the smaller side mesh pocket is perfect for storing smaller items like masks or snorkels. The water-resistant pocket is particularly useful for keeping your phone, keys, or other electronics safe and dry, which is essential for any outdoor adventure.
- High-Quality Zipper: The luggage-grade zipper is one of the standout features. Built to endure frequent travel and heavy use, the smooth closure system ensures your items stay securely inside without any fuss. It’s a reassuring feature, especially for those concerned about the bag's longevity during long trips or rough handling.
- Easy to Clean and Maintain: One of the most appreciated aspects of this bag is its ease of maintenance. The mesh material allows for sand, dirt, and small debris to easily shake off, preventing the build-up of unwanted mess inside the bag. For those who frequently find themselves on sandy beaches or in muddy environments, this is a huge benefit.
- Perfect for Travel: This bag is not only for storing gear but is also a great travel companion. It’s compact, portable, and easy to carry around with its convenient design. Its versatility is perfect for scuba divers, snorkelers, and beach-goers alike. The bag’s structure allows it to be easily packed into a car trunk or stowed away in overhead compartments when traveling.
Cons:
- Large Size Might Be Overwhelming for Some: With its 90L capacity and dimensions of 29"x14"x14", this bag might be a bit large for those who prefer compact storage options. While it’s excellent for storing larger diving gear, it could be too bulky for casual users who only need to carry a few items, such as swimmers or light snorkelers.
- Limited Internal Organization: While the bag does come with several pockets, the internal space might feel a bit unorganized for some users. The lack of internal dividers means that gear might shift around during transport, and without a proper system, it could be a bit frustrating to find exactly what you need when you need it.
- Not Completely Waterproof: Despite its water-resistant pockets, the bag itself is made of mesh, which means it's not entirely waterproof. While the water-resistant pockets can protect small items like phones and keys, the rest of the bag offers no guarantee that your equipment will stay dry during heavy rainfall or if submerged.
- No Shoulder Strap: While the bag is versatile in terms of its compartments and storage, it lacks a dedicated shoulder strap, which could be a deal-breaker for those who prefer carrying the bag across their shoulder, especially for longer distances. While it is easy to carry by hand, a shoulder strap would have made it more comfortable for extended use.
- May Not Hold Up Under Extreme Weight: Though it is built to carry up to 30 lbs, the mesh material, despite its durability, may not be ideal for extremely heavy equipment over long periods. For those with large, bulky gear, it could stretch or lose shape under constant heavy load, which could affect the overall longevity of the bag.
